A personal and affectionate letter from the English poet, writer and broadcaster, John Betjeman (JB) to Vernon St. John, 6th Viscount Bolingbroke, 30th June 1969. In it JB responds to Lord Bolingbroke's congratulations on JB's receiving a peerage. Includes JB's recollections of a visit by Lord Bolingbroke to his former home in Uffington, Wiltshire. He writes:

'I remember that your motorcar had a khaki coloured folding roof, which certainly dates the time to well before the war'.
